Hi Abrar, you have already mentioned the names of top universities in Singapore like NUS, NTU, SIM University, SMU etc. But none of these provide MBA for freshers and all of these require at least 2 yrs of full time work experience and GMAT. For freshers MBA the choices are MDIS, James cook University.
If you would like to study at NUS or SMU kind of Universities then you can try for a specialist masters course in business or some subject related to your bachelors degree.

Hi Mr. Ramanuj,
The most important thing which one should keep in mind while choosing his/her Education stream is his/her interests and career aspirations. As your son has done Commerce without Math the best option for him would be BBA. However, all the other options which are open to commerce students with Math are also open to Commerce students without Math like CA, CWA, CFA, & CS etc. However if he wants to go for some vocational courses he can opt for courses like fashion designing, interior designing etc.

eligibility to any Post Graduation in Management is minimum 50% score in a three years graduation degree in any stream from a recognised University and if you choose to do it from an AICTE approved Institution, you also have to appear in MAT or CAT, irrespective of the fact that how much you score.
